NettetAn adult human on an average excretes 1 to 1.8 liters of urine per day. It is light yellow in color, slightly acidic with a characteristic odor. The composition of urine is 95% water, 2.5 % urea, and 2.5% other waste. As urea is the major excretory waste humans are considered ureotelic. So, the correct answer is '1-1.8 Litres'. NettetFor most people, the normal number of times to urinate per day is between 6 – 7 in a 24 hour period. Between 4 and 10 times a day can also be normal if that person is healthy and happy with the number of times they visit the toilet. Normal urinary frequency also depends on how much fluid you drink in a day and the types of fluid that you drink.

Nettet12. apr. 2024 · Dehydration and overhydration are common causes of electrolyte imbalances. When you don’t drink enough fluids or too much fluid, your body becomes dehydrated or overhydrated, respectively, and these states can cause an imbalance in electrolyte levels.
